With the new year, two new films in the catalog

“OH WILLY…” by Emma de SWAEF and Marc ROELS
Franco-Belgian-Dutch co-production (Beast Animation Polaris Film Production & Finance, Roll on Monday !, the Luster Films).
‘Cartoon d’Or’ for Best Animated Short Film in Europe
Shortlisted at the Oscars
Nominated at CESARS in the categories "Best short film" and "Best animated film" (ceremony on 25 January).

“LIKE RABBITS” by Osman Cerfon
Production: “I am very happy”
“Like rabbits” is the second part of “Chronicles of bad luck”. The man with the fish head continues his melancholy stroll through a fun fair, randomly distributing, its bubbles of misfortune. As its title suggests, there is a lot of talk of rabbits, but don't let that make you forget the crows. And if you see in this movie, a sordid portrait of a badly barred humanity, your mind may have gone awry.

“The Monster of Nix” by Rosto enfin available on DVD !

The animated film “Nix's monster” (30′) is finally available on DVD-PAL with English subtitles, French, and dutch.
You can order it for 14,50 euros (shipping costs included for Europe) and 16 euros (rest of the world).
The DVD comes with a set of stickers and access to the online documentary / making-of of 50′ to learn all about the making of the film.

Note for the United States (and other NTSC regions): le DVD region 0 works on computers and basic DVD players, but NTSC televisions don't play it.

Send us a message at boutique@autourdeminuit.com with the subject line : “Order NIX DVD”

The Monster of Nix in the race for the Caesar 2013 for best animated film

“The Monster of Nix” from Rosto et “After me” by Paul Emile Boucher, Thomas Bozovic, Madeleine Charruaud, Dorianne Fibleuil, Benjamin Flouw, Mickaël Riciotti and Antoine Robert, have been selected from 10 short films by the Animation Committee of the Academy of Cinema Arts and Techniques to compete for the César 2013 for best animated film.

The nominations will be revealed at the press conference to announce the nominations on Friday 25 January 2013.

BABIOLS, find them from September on CANAL + !!!

Series of 23 x 2′ directed by Mathieu Auvray
Written By Mathieu Auvray, Sebastien Ors, Nicolas Schmerkin, Am, The devil
Produced by Autour de Minuit
in coproduction with Canal+, Rocketta-Valk, Nozon Paris

Little toys from our childhood are lost in our absurd and violent adult world.
They wander in search of love, hoping to stand out, not just.

Trinkets attempts to point out the enormities and aberrations of our lifestyles through the naive eyes of small characters, offering another vision of the world, comparable to the one we had as a child.
Between fable and biting satire, the series declines caricatural situations pushed to their paroxysm in order to underline our most paradoxical behaviors.
